What features should I consider when choosing a hunting knife set?

Choosing the right hunting knife set can greatly enhance your experience in the field. Here are some key features to consider:

Blade Material

The quality of the blade material is crucial. Look for stainless steel blades for their rust resistance and durability. For a sharper edge, carbon steel is another excellent option but requires more maintenance.

Blade Design

Different blade designs serve various purposes. A drop point blade is ideal for skinning, while a clip point can offer precision for detail work. Choose a design that suits your hunting needs.

Handle Comfort

The handle should provide a secure grip, especially in wet conditions. Materials like rubber or textured grip can prevent slipping. Ensure the handle fits comfortably in your hand to avoid fatigue.

Sheath Quality

A good sheath protects the blade and keeps you safe. Leather and nylon are popular materials. Look for a sheath that allows for easy access while ensuring the blade is securely held.

Weight and Balance

A well-balanced knife will be easier to control while cutting. Consider the weight of the knife; lighter models are easier to carry, but heavier ones might provide more power.

Versatility

Opt for a hunting knife set that includes multiple knives for different tasks. A combination of a fixed blade and a folding knife can cover various situations efficiently.

By considering these features, you can select a hunting knife set that meets your needs and enhances your hunting adventures.

What materials are best for hunting knife blades?

Choosing the right material for hunting knife blades is crucial for performance and durability. There are several options, each with its own benefits and drawbacks.

Stainless Steel

Stainless steel is popular for its corrosion resistance and ease of maintenance. It maintains sharp edges well and is ideal for wet environments. However, some stainless steels may not be as tough as other materials.

High Carbon Steel

High carbon steel offers excellent edge retention and is easy to sharpen. It is favored by many hunters for its strength and durability. However, this material can rust if not properly cared for, requiring regular maintenance.

Tool Steel

Tool steel is known for its toughness and edge retention. This material can withstand heavy use and is perfect for demanding tasks. It often comes in various grades, providing options for various needs. Like high carbon steel, it may require more maintenance.

Damascus Steel

Damascus steel is a blend of different metals, offering unique aesthetic appeal and toughness. It combines the best features of various steels, providing excellent sharpness and strength. However, it can be more expensive due to the intricate manufacturing process.

In summary, the best material for your hunting knife blade depends on your specific needs. Consider factors like maintenance, edge retention, and the environments in which you'll be using your knife.

How do I know if a hunting knife is of good quality?

When purchasing a hunting knife, quality is paramount. Here are some key factors to consider:

1. Blade Material

High-quality hunting knives are typically made from stainless steel or high-carbon steel. Stainless steel offers excellent corrosion resistance, while high-carbon steel provides superior edge retention.

2. Blade Design

Look for a blade design that suits your specific needs. Fixed blades are sturdier and better for heavy tasks, while folding knives are more portable and safer for carrying.

3. Handle Comfort

A good hunting knife should have a comfortable handle that provides a secure grip. Materials like rubber, thermoplastic, or hardwood can enhance usability and reduce slippage.

4. Full Tang Construction

A knife with full tang construction means the blade extends through the handle. This design ensures durability and balance, making your knife more reliable during use.

5. Brand Reputation

Research established brands with positive customer reviews. A well-regarded manufacturer can often guarantee quality craftsmanship and performance.

By paying attention to these factors, you can ensure that your hunting knife is of top-notch quality, ready to accompany you on your outdoor adventures.

What Safety Tips Should I Follow When Using Hunting Knives?

Using hunting knives can be a rewarding experience, but safety must be your top priority. Here are some essential safety tips to keep in mind:

Always Keep Your Knife Sharp

A sharp knife is safer than a dull one. A dull blade requires more force to cut, increasing the risk of slipping and potential injury. Regularly sharpen your hunting knife to maintain its effectiveness.

Hold the Knife Properly

Always use a firm grip on the knife handle, keeping your fingers away from the blade. When passing a knife to someone, lay it down with the handle facing toward them rather than handing it over directly.

Use the Right Knife for the Task

Different tasks require different types of knives. Always select the appropriate knife for your specific hunting needs to ensure safety and efficiency.

Cut Away from Your Body

When using a hunting knife, always cut away from your body, keeping your hands and fingers clear of the blade’s path. This simple practice can prevent accidental slips from causing harm.

Store Your Knife Safely

When not in use, store your hunting knife in a sheath or holder. This protects the blade and reduces the risk of accidental cuts.

Be Aware of Your Surroundings

Always be mindful of your surroundings while using a hunting knife. Ensure that no one is in close proximity, and remain focused on the task at hand to avoid distractions that could lead to accidents.

By following these tips, you can enjoy a safer hunting experience. Remember, safety first! Stay alert and always prioritize proper knife handling.
